I want to just talk very briefly about two or three things. First, the issue of testing. And how that has really changed the complexion of the approach that were going to be able to take. Testing was an issue, we had many questions of testing in this room for a number of times. Now that we literally have hundreds and hundreds of thousands of testing out there, there are a few things that we can do with that. One of the things is that when we make policy about what were going to be doing with the rest of the country, particularly those areas that are not hot spots, we need to know whether the penetrance of infection is there. We need to put a light on those dark spots that we dont know. We have to act policywise on data. And were going to be getting more data, a lot more data. The other thing is that the areas of the country that are not hot spots, that are not going through the terrible ordeal that new york and california and Washington State are going through, they still have a window of significant degree of being able to contain. In other words, when you test, you find somebody, you isolate them, you get them out of circulation. And you do the contact tracing. When you have a big outbreak, its tough to do anything but mitigation. We have an opportunity now that we have the availability of testing to do that. So youre going to be hearing more about how we can inform where were going, particularly because we have the ability to test. The second thing is i want to reiterate what dr. Birx said about new york. Its a very serious situation. Theyve suffered terribly through no fault of their own. But what were seeing now is that understandably people want to get out of new york. Theyre going to florida. Theyre going to long island. Theyre going different places. The idea, if you look at the statistics, its disturbing. About one per thousand of these individuals are infected. Thats about eight to 10 times more than in other areas. Which means when they go to another place, for their own safety, theyve got to be careful, monitor themselves. If they get sick, bring it to the attention of a physician. Get tested. Also, the idea about selfisolate for two weeks will be very important. We dont want that to be another seeding point for the rest of the country, wherever they go. Thirdly, just one comment about drugs and the testing of drugs. You know, you heard yesterday about drugs being out there that physicians on an offlabel way can prescribe it, to give people hope of something that hasnt been definitively proven to work, but that might have some hope. I dont want anybody to forget that simultaneously, with our doing that, were also doing randomized Clinical Trials on a number of candidates. Youve heard about candidates, but there are others in the pipeline where well be able to design the study and over a period of time, particularly since we have so many infections, well be able to determine definitively, are these safe . And are they effective . Were talking about certain drugs. All of these are in the pipeline now queuing up to be able to go into clinical trial. Ill stop there. President trump thank you. Great job. This legislation is urgently needed to bolster the economy, provide cash injections and liquidity and stabilize financial markets, to get us through a difficult period. A difficult and challenging period in the economy. Facing us right now. But also to position us for what i think can be an economic rebound later this year. We started the year very strong. And then we got hit by the coronavirus in ways that probably nobody imagined possible. Were dealing with that as best we can. This package will be the single largest main street Assistance Program in the history of the United States. The single largest main street Assistance Program in the history of the United States. Phase two delivered the sick leave for individuals, hourly workers, families and so forth. Phase three, a significant package for Small Businesses, loan guarantees will be included. Were going to take out expenses and lost revenues. As the president said, eligibility requires worker retention. We will maintain the people eligible will maintain their payrolls during this crisis period. And on top of that, well have direct deposit checks, abruptly 3,000 for a family of four, and that will bridge to enhanced, plusedup Unemployment Insurance benefits. That will essentially take those up to full wages. One, two, three, four. You know, a strong work force requires strong business. Mr. Kudlow you cant have a job without a business to work for. The hope here is that the companies that were operating very well at the beginning of the year when the economy was in good shape, we will help them and their employees get through this tough period so they will come out the other side. Lets say this later this spring or summer, and will continue their operations. Thats the key point. Now, dont forget theres income tax deferral for individuals and corporations without interest in penalties. Theres student loan principal and interest deferrals without any penalties. And finally, i want to mention, the treasurys Exchange Stabilization refund, that will be replenished. Its important because that fund opens the door for Federal Reserve fire power to deal, a broadbased way throughout the economy, for distressed industries, for Small Businesses, for financial turbulence. Youve already seen the fed take action. They intend to take more action. And in order to get this, we have to replenish the treasurys emergency fund. Its very, very important. Not everybody understands that. That fund, by the way, will be overseen by an Oversight Board and inspector general. It will be completely transparent. So the total package comes to roughly 6 trillion. 2 trillion direct assistance, roughly 4 trillion in Federal Reserve lending power. Again, it will be the largest main street financial package in the history of the United States. Liquidity and cash for families, small business, individuals, unemployed to keep this thing going. Since the president said you and dr. Birx and others will be guiding him and making the decision, where you are now, in timeline of 19 days . Dr. Fauci thats really very flexible. We just had a conversation with the president in the oval office talking about, you know, you can look at a date, but you have to be very flexible. On a literally day by day and week by week basis. You need to evaluate the feasibility of what youre trying to do. You asked for what kind of metrics, what kind of data. When you look at the country, obviously no one is going to want to tone down things when you see whats going on in a place like new york city. Thats just good Public Health practice and common sense. But the country is a big country and there are areas of the country, and i refer to this in my opening remarks, that we really need to know more about what the penetrance is there. If we do the kind of testing well be doing, and testing will be associated with tracing, and you find after a period of time that there are areas that are very different from other areas of the country, you may not want to essentially treat it as just one force for the entire country. But look at flexibility in different areas. So i think people might get the misinterpretation, youre just going lift everything up and even somebodys going like that, i mean, thats not going to happen. Its going to be looking at the data. And what we dont have right now that we really do need is we need to know whats going on in those areas of the country where there isnt an obvious outbreak. Is there something underneath the surface that says, wait a minute, you better be careful and really clamp down, or what looks there that you dont really have to be as harsh as you are in other areas . So its looking at information that up to this point we never had. So its a flexible situation.
